Memory Chip Shortage Powers AI Boom Profits 2025
An unprecedented surge in AI-driven demand for computer memory has created a global shortage and sent prices skyrocketing. This situation creates a powerful tailwind for memory chip manufacturers who are pivotal to the AI supply chain.

About This Group of Stocks
Our Expert Thinking
The explosive growth of artificial intelligence has created an unprecedented demand for specialised memory chips like DRAM and HBM. This surge has far outpaced global supply capacity, creating a powerful market imbalance that's driving prices higher and generating significant opportunities for companies in the memory supply chain.
What You Need to Know
This shortage isn't temporary - AI applications require vast amounts of high-performance memory, and current production can't keep up. The resulting price inflation affects everything from data centres to consumer devices, creating a sustained tailwind for memory manufacturers and their suppliers across the semiconductor ecosystem.
